Arunachal Govt Holds High Level Meeting with AAPSU on Chakma-Hajong Refugee Issue

The Government of Arunachal Pradesh on Tuesday held a closed door meeting with the All Arunachal Pradesh Students’ Union (AAPSU) to address concerns related to illegal immigrants and Chakma-Hajong refugees.
The talks follow AAPSU’s protest rally held on June 16, during which a memorandum was submitted to the Union Home Minister, Amit Shah through the Governor of Arunachal Pradesh. AAPSU in the memorandum demanded immediate deportation or relocation of illegal immigrants, citing demographic threats, land encroachment, and misuse of tribal welfare schemes.
The high level meeting which lasted for over three hours was chaired by Arunachal Pradesh Home Minister, Mama Natung.
Speaking to the media after the meeting, AAPSU President Dozi Tana Tara said, “Today’s meeting was focused on the refugee issue and the challenges faced by our indigenous people. Detailed outcomes will be shared once the minutes are officially released.”
However, Home Minister Mama Natung did not make any public statement after the meeting.
